If f(x) = 2x² + 5, then what is the remainder when f (x) is divided by x – 10?
photoshop1234 [79]

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

x - 10 = 0

x = 10

f(10) = 2*10² + 5 = 2*100 + 5 = 200 + 5

      = 205

Remainder = 205

Step-by-step explanation:The cost of an adult ticket to the show is $5.5

The cost of a student ticket to the show is $4.25

A family is purchasing 2 adult tickets and 3 student tickets. This means that the total cost of 2 adult tickets would be

2 × 5.5 = $11

It also means that the total cost of 3 student tickets would be

3 × 4.25 = $12.75

The total cost of 2 adult tickets and 3 student tickets would be

11 + 12.75 = $23.75

If the family pays $25, the exact amount of change they should receive is

25 - 23.75 = $1.25
